Kannada-English dictionary
Source: Alar: Kannada-English corpusToṃḍalu (ತೊಂಡಲು):—
1) [noun] a kind of ornament made of pearls, worn on the head.
2) [noun] a number of people or things arranged so as to form a line; a row.
3) [noun] a string of flowers.
4) [noun] a kind of ornament tied on the forehead of a bridegroom.
--- OR ---
Toṃḍalu (ತೊಂಡಲು):—[noun] a kind of bird.
